Carlson Laboratories supports the American Heart Association’s Go Red for Women campaign

Chiropractic Economics January 29, 2015

CarlsonLabsJanuary 29, 2015 — Go Red for Women is the American Heart Association’s campaign to raise awareness regarding cardiovascular disease in women.

According to the American Heart Association, heart disease is the leading cause of death for women in the United States. Friday, February 6, 2015 is National Wear Red Day.

Thousands of individuals and companies are raising awareness about heart disease by wearing red on this day.

Carlson Laboratories is proud to be supporting this event by providing a free red apron to health food store owners and their staff to wear.

“We at Carlson have been promoting awareness about cardiovascular health since my parents started our company in 1965,” says Kirsten Carlson, vice president of marketing for Carlson Laboratories. “Please help continue raising awareness by taking part in this special event.”
